Introduction

The Yokogawa SB401-10 S2 Bus Interface Slave Module is a key communication component used in Yokogawa distributed control systems. It provides reliable ESB bus connectivity between Field Control Units and I/O modules, ensuring synchronized and stable data exchange across industrial automation networks.

Designed for high availability and industrial robustness, this module is widely used in process industries such as oil & gas, chemical processing, and power generation. Its stable communication performance makes it essential for large-scale control system architectures requiring continuous and dependable operation.

Technical FAQs

1. What is the main function of this module?
It acts as a slave interface module for ESB bus communication in DCS systems.

2. What systems is it used with?
It is used in Yokogawa CENTUM distributed control system architectures.

3. Is it a control module or communication module?
It is strictly a communication interface module, not a control processor.

4. What does the “S2” suffix indicate?
It represents a specific revision/variant within the SB401 series lineup.

5. Does it support redundancy?
Yes, it can be used in redundant configurations depending on system design.

6. Can it handle I/O expansion?
Yes, it supports expansion of distributed I/O nodes via ESB bus.
